Design principles for cabin gardens

Cabaña gardens are lovely plants and mixed with a natural and informal style. The key is to focus on informality and vibrant colors, creating a cozy atmosphere.

Emphasizing informality

An informal design is essential for a cabin garden. Natural paths and curved lines help achieve this aspect.

Dense plantation makes the garden feel full and lush, using ornamental and edible plants. The integration of vegetables and herbs with flowers with flowers contributes to the usefulness and beauty of the garden.

Materials such as stone and wood add character and warmth. Choose furniture that looks comfortable and welcoming, such as worn banks or wooden chairs.

This creates a space where visitors feel comfortable and can enjoy the splendor of nature.

Incorporating colorful flowers

Colorful flowers are crucial in a cabin garden. Opt for a mixture of flowers such as roses, margaritas and lavender.

These flowers add visual interest and create a fragrant and cozy atmosphere. The use of a variety of plants heights can add depth and texture to the garden.

Consider planting flowers that bloom at different times for the garden to have color throughout the year. Include climbing plants such as Mother to add vertical interest and charm.

A reflective selection of plants can cause a vibrant and animated environment, attracting bees and butterflies that contribute to garden health.
